Literature Review Low-income and minority students who attend the most

selective colleges and universities are more likely to graduate (Bowen & Bok, 2000; Bowen, Chingos, & McPherson, 2009).

Peer support, faculty support, academic advising, and mentorship aid in minority and underrepresented students’ college retention in STEM (Espinosa, 2011; McPherson, 2013; Ong, Wright, Espinosa, & Orfield, 2011).

In this presentation, underrepresented students are defined as low-income, minorities, women (in STEM) and adult learners in STEM majors.

Research has shown that minorities and women are underrepresented in STEM fields and careers (Committee on Underrepresented Groups and the Expansion of the Science and Engineering Workforce Pipeline et al., 2011, National Science Foundation, 2011, 2013).

Learning Communities (Kuh, 2008) “The key goals for learning communities are to

encourage integration of learning across courses and to involve students with “big questions” that matter beyond the classroom.”

“Students take two or more linked courses as a group and work closely with one another and with their professors.”

Undergraduate Research (Kuh, 2008)

“Many colleges and universities are now providing research experiences for students in all disciplines.”

“The goal is to involve students with actively contested questions, empirical observation, cutting-edge technologies, and the sense of excitement that comes from working to answer important questions.”
